How to get to Wuppertal

Plane

The best way to get to Wuppertal by plane is to fly into Düsseldorf International Airport and take the S-Bahn S8 or S68 to Wuppertal Hauptbahnhof.

Car

If you are driving to Wuppertal, the best route is via the A46 motorway. You can also use the A1, A3 or A45 depending on your starting point.

Train

If you are traveling from within Germany, taking the train is a great way to get to Wuppertal. The city has its own Hauptbahnhof with connections to other major German cities.

Boat

There are no direct boat routes to Wuppertal as it is an inland city. However, you can take a river cruise to nearby cities like Cologne or Düsseldorf and then take public transportation or drive to Wuppertal.

Bus

Taking the bus to Wuppertal is another option, with regular services running from major cities in Germany and surrounding countries. The main bus station is the Wuppertal Central Bus Station.
